DAYITVA PRADAN UTSAV (CONFERRAL OF SUCCESSION)
Tue Apr 21, 2015


His Holiness Padmabhushan Former Jagadguru Shankaracharya Param Gurudev Mahamandaleshwar Swami Satyamitranand Giri Ji Maharaj announced His retirement from the Presidency of the renowned Bharat Mata Mandir and Samanvaya Seva Trust, Haridwar and appointed His senior most disciple, His Holiness Acharya Mahamandaleshwar Swami Avdheshanand Giri Ji  Maharaj as His prime successor. 

This sacred event celebrating the conferral of succession and transference of responsibilities was held on 21st April on the auspicious occasion of AkshayTritiya in the divine presence of eminent saints and spiritual leaders from all over the country.

The programme commenced with the Deep Prajjvalan ceremony, i.e. lighting of the traditional lamp which was accompanied by swasti-vachan, soulful chanting of mantras for peace and wellbeing. His Holiness Mahamandaleshwar Swami Satyamitranand Giri Ji Maharaj, alongwith His Holiness Karshni Peethadhishwar Pujya Swami Gurusharanand Ji Maharaj affectionately annointed a tilak on the forehead of His Holiness Acharya Mahamandaleshwar Swami Avdheshanand Giri Ji Maharaj and completed the traditional rituals of the conferral of succession. 

On this ocassion, General Secretary of Akhara Parishad and Secretary of Shri Panchdasnam Juna Akhara Swami Hari Giri Ji Maharaj, Secretary of Shri Taponidhi Niranjani Akhara Swami Ramanand Puri Ji Maharaj, Secretary of Shri Panchayati Nirvani Akhara Swami Ravindrapuri Ji Maharaj, Nirvaanpeethadhishwar Acharya Mahamandaleshwar Swami Vishokanand Bharti Ji Maharaj, Anandpeethadhishwar Acharya Mahamandaleshwar Swami Gahanand Ji Maharaj, Mahamandaleshwar Swami Vishwesharanand Ji, Surat Giri Bangla Ji, Mahamandaleshwar Swami Kailashanand Brahmachari, Pujya Swami Govind Giri Ji Maharaj and many other prominent saints from different parts of the country were present.
